Gender inequality in Alberta manifests in various ways, including the gender pay gap and underrepresentation in leadership roles. Efforts to address this issue include promoting equal pay, supporting professional growth for women, and advocating for policies that offer work-life balance, such as parental leave and flexible working conditions.

  1. What is the gender pay gap in Alberta? The gender pay gap in Alberta refers to the difference in average earnings between men and women, often driven by factors such as occupational segregation and unequal pay for equal work.
  2. How is gender inequality addressed in Alberta workplaces? Efforts include promoting equal pay, supporting women's professional growth, and implementing policies like parental leave and flexible work arrangements to improve work-life balance.
  3. Why are women underrepresented in leadership roles in Alberta? Barriers include workplace biases, lack of mentorship opportunities, and structural challenges that limit access to senior positions for women.
